Not allowed to enter a casino due to past bad or criminal behavior.
A pass line or come bet for which the player doesn't take odds (odds being the best bet in craps) or a don't pass or don't come where the player doesn't lay odds.
A useless card that cannot form part of a low hand. E.g. a 9 or higher card in an 8-or-better game.
The point at which a player is not losing overall.
Placing pass line and/or come bets, the usual way players bet. Often seen (erroneously) as playing "against" the house.
Something (most often money) given to a person as an incentive to sign up or play. Usually comes with qualifying conditions, e.g. playing a certain amount.
See also: Cashable Bonus, Sticky Bonus, Non-cashable Bonus, Play Bonus
A slot machine that rewards playing the maximum amount on a spin by multiplying jackpot payouts.
Synonym: Bonus Multiplier or Wild Slots
